French Senate Approves Adoption Component Of Marriage Equality Bill

Tonight the French Senate approved the portion of its marriage equality bill that guarantees adoption rights to same-sex couples.  Anti-gay groups had been clinging to that aspect of the bill as their last possible chance to block final passage. Uruguay Finalizes Marriage Equality

Today the finishing touches on Uruguay’s marriage equality bill were made after minor changes to the original bill were reconciled between the two national legislative chambers. President Jose Mujica has promised to sign the bill and marriages should commence within a few months.
